Responsibilities

On the Real Time Operations (RTO) Live Streaming team we are building the next generation of live streaming for mission-critical situations.

Through Fusus we unify live video, sensor data, and alerts into a single operational view to empower agencies to make faster, better decisions.

We design, deploy and manage hardware + software used by first responders and security professionals worldwide.

As a Senior Software Engineer you will: Build the native foundation for edge video and IoT intelligence across Axon Body cameras and FususCOREs.

Own high-performance pipelines from sensor to inference.

Shape how SDKs are consumed across mobile and backend surfaces.
